THEFT OF EDUCATION BOARD MONEY
0 CHARGE AGAINST SECRETARY. By Telegraph—Prees Aasoolatlen Nelson, September 27. Norman Rule Williams, secretary 01 the Nelson Education Board, was charged in the Magistrate’s Court to-day with the theft of .£5O, the property of tho board. The police applied for a remand to Thursday, and stated that other charges, involving £3OB 125., were pending. A remand was granted, and bail of £4OO was allowed.
